What is PRP (Platelet-Rich Plasma) Therapy?

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P) therapy is an innovative, non-surgical treatment that utilizes the healing properties of your own blood to promote natural healing and tissue regeneration. This therapy is highly effective for treating various conditions, including joint pain, soft tissue injuries, and chronic inflammation.

How Does PRP Therapy Work?

Concentration

The concentrated platelets, rich in growth factors, are collected and prepared for injection.

Injection

The PRP is injected into the targeted area, such as a joint, tendon, or ligament, using precise imaging guidance to ensure accuracy.

Blood Collection

A small amount of your blood is drawn from a vein, usually in your arm

Centrifugation

The blood is placed in a centrifuge, a machine that spins at high speeds to separate the platelets from the rest of the blood components.

What to Expect During Your PRP Treatment

Preparation

Before your PRP injection, your doctor will numb the area with a local anesthetic. The procedure can be performed under IV sedation if needed.

Procedure

The entire process typically takes about one to two hours. Using fluoroscopy guidance, the doctor will accurately inject the PRP into the injured area.

Post-Treatment

After the injection, you may experience mild discomfort and swelling for a few days. Most patients notice pain relief and improved mobility within a few weeks.
